The City of Hamilton initiated the Municipal Class Environmental Assessment in order to assess and evaluate options for widening both Barton Street and Fifty Road within the study area. The City is planning improvements to better serve our community by enhancing ways in which you commute by car, truck, transit, bike or on foot!
We want your input
The public has the opportunity to provide input at key stages of the project process.

Report to Council
this is an upcoming stage for Barton Street and Fifty Road Improvements EA
Take the Environmental Study Report (ESR) to Council for permission to place for 30 Day Public Review. (Q3, 2021)
30 Day Public Review
this is an upcoming stage for Barton Street and Fifty Road Improvements EA
Opportunity for final comments on the Final Draft ESR and appeal, based on Indigenous and Treaty Rights, to the Ministry of Environment, Conservation and Parks. (Q4, 2021)
